Verb

charred verb

  1. To burn something to charcoal.
  2. To burn slightly or superficially so as to affect colour.

charred verb

  1. To turn, especially away or aside.
  2. To work, especially to do housework; to work by the day, without being a regularly hired servant.
  3. To perform; to do; to finish.
  4. To work or hew (stone, etc.).

Adjective

charred adjective

  1. Burnt, carbonized.
